How can CX ambassadors effectively navigate resistance from senior leadership when advocating for customer-centric innovation, and what strategies can they employ to overcome objections and drive alignment towards implementing new strategies in a rapidly changing market?
CX ambassadors can effectively navigate resistance from senior leadership by first understanding their concerns and motivations. They can then tailor their messaging to highlight the benefits of customer-centric innovation, such as increased customer loyalty and revenue growth. To overcome objections, ambassadors can provide data-driven evidence and case studies to demonstrate the success of similar strategies in the market. Additionally, they can collaborate with key stakeholders and involve them in the decision-making process to drive alignment and ensure buy-in for implementing new strategies.
